The US Transceivers compatible X2-10GB-LR is a high-performance 10GBASE-LR X2 form factor transceiver designed for long-reach single-mode fiber applications. Operating at a wavelength of 1310 nm, this module supports data rates of 10 Gbps and delivers reliable transmission over distances of up to 10 km, making it well-suited for enterprise and data center environments requiring extended reach connectivity.

This X2 transceiver is a fully compatible replacement for the X2-10GB-LR and is engineered to meet or exceed the performance specifications of the original module. It features an LC Duplex connector interface and supports Digital Diagnostic Monitoring (DDM) for real-time visibility into key optical parameters such as temperature, voltage, and optical power levels.

The US Transceivers compatible X2-10GB-LR is TAA compliant and manufactured in accordance with RoHS, CE, and REACH standards, ensuring it meets regulatory requirements for a wide range of deployment scenarios including campus backbones, metropolitan area networks, and enterprise core switching infrastructure.

Form Factor

X2

Connector Type

LC Duplex

Fiber Type

Single-Mode Fiber (SMF)

Transmitter Type

Laser (DFB)

Receiver Type

PIN Photodetector

Transmitter Power

-8.2 dBm min to 0.5 dBm max

Receiver Sensitivity

-14.4 dBm min (max BER 1E-12)

Extinction Ratio

3.5 dB min

Receiver Overload

0.5 dBm max

Max Power Consumption

3.5 W

DDM/DOM

Yes

Operating Temperature

0 to 70 deg C

Storage Temperature

-40 to 85 deg C

Compliance/Standards

RoHS, CE, REACH, TAA, IEEE 802.3ae, 10GBASE-LR MSA

Application

Data Center Interconnect, Enterprise Campus Backbone, Metropolitan Area Networking, Core Switch Uplinks
